Examining the Longevity of Jonathan the Tortoise and His Comparison to mr. Pickles

Jonathan, the Seychelles giant tortoise, stands as a remarkable specimen of longevity, reportedly living for more than 190 years. his age, which surpasses a century compared to the more youthful Mr. Pickles of Houston, offers a engaging glimpse into the world of tortoise lifespans. Unlike Mr. Pickles, whose life is intertwined with the vibrant culture of a city known for its culinary diversity and warmth, Jonathan’s existence has taken place on the remote island of Saint Helena, where he has seen centuries of change in the world around him. The longevity of such tortoises is attributed to several factors, including their slow metabolism, minimal environmental stressors, and a diet largely comprised of high-fiber vegetation.

When examining the care required for these ancient creatures, it becomes essential to note the varying conditions that can impact their lifespan. As an example,Jonathan benefits from an habitat that prioritizes his health,whereas Mr. Pickles, while cherished by his owners and beloved by the community, may experience unique challenges characteristic of urban life. Potential threats, such as pollution and habitat disruption, could impose limitations on Mr. Pickles’ longevity that Jonathan has largely avoided due to his idyllic habitat. The contrast between these two tortoises serves to highlight not just the differences in their ages, but the broader conversation about the factors influencing the lifespans of tortoises across species.
